Hi all,

Quick note before the weekly sync: the garbage-collection pause investigation on the Matchline matching service is changing hands. We've been seeing 800ms stop-the-world pauses during peak matching windows, and the heap-tuning experiments from last sprint only got us halfway. Since the Fernbrook launch is eating my calendar, I'm passing this to someone with more JVM-internals depth. Please route any new pause reports and profiling dumps to them starting Monday. The new owner of this workstream is below.

approver of yajef-fajef = Oliwyn Silion Kasok Kasox

The Trimdeck API reduces container image size by pruning unused layers and squashing build stages. Submit an image digest to the analyze endpoint; Trimdeck returns a slimming plan you can apply via the rebuild endpoint. Plans are cached for six hours. All requests to the internal Trimdeck staging instance authenticate with the key below.

service key, yadug-bajog: zpat3_pou

Hi Tomas — passing you the Mapletile release. The tile-rendering cache layer is the big change: eviction is now LRU with a size cap, and warm-up runs at boot. Please eyeball cache_shard.rs before sign-off; the rest is plumbing. Artifact's already built on the Quarrow runner. To verify it, use the deploy key below.

release key, fahaf-bajof: bky3_Xam

**Ticket #—: Locked vault blocking wiki role updates**

The Fernwick wiki's role-based access module cannot be edited because the permissions vault sealed itself after three failed unlock attempts by the automation account. Until it is reopened, no reviewer or editor roles can be granted, which blocks the Harrowmere release sign-off. Please verify the automation account is disabled before unsealing, and record the action in the change log. The recovery passphrase needed to unseal the vault is provided immediately below.

recovery phrase for fawif-tajeg: norael-aldmir-casir-brivan-ulaion